121276338706432 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of seven hundred sixty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 121276338706432:

211 × 7 × 13 × 23 × 31 × 973

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 7 × 13 × 23 × 31 × 97 × 97 × 97)

How big is 121276338706432?
  • 121,276,338,706,432 seconds is equal to 3,856,212 years, 22 weeks, 5 days, 14 hours, 53 minutes, 52 seconds.
  • To count from 1 to 121,276,338,706,432 would take you about nine million, six hundred forty thousand, five hundred thirty-one years!

    This is a very rough estimate, based on a speaking rate of half a second every third order of magnitude. If you speak quickly, you could probably say any randomly-chosen number between one and a thousand in around half a second. Very big numbers obviously take longer to say, so we add half a second for every extra x1000. (We do not count involuntary pauses, bathroom breaks or the necessity of sleep in our calculation!)
